Actualités: Gare la Question d'Orient! is a 1841 by Clémente Pruche, a Romanticism work, held at Cleveland Museum of Art.
This painting depicts a scene of three individuals in a room, with one person holding a broom and another handing a paper to someone. The room has a doorway and a sign on the wall with writing. The people are dressed in old-fashioned clothing. The image appears to be a scene from everyday life, with the people engaged in ordinary activities. The sign on the wall suggests that there may be some kind of announcement or message being conveyed. The painting is a work by Clémente Pruche, a French artist associated with the Romanticism movement.
Clémente Pruche (1811–1890) was a French artist, born in Paris.
